Form preview

Get the free Credit Card Authorization Release

Get Form
We are not affiliated with any brand or entity on this form
Illustration
Fill out
Complete the form online in a simple drag-and-drop editor.
Illustration
eSign
Add your legally binding signature or send the form for signing.
Illustration
Share
Share the form via a link, letting anyone fill it out from any device.
Illustration
Export
Download, print, email, or move the form to your cloud storage.

Why pdfFiller is the best tool for your documents and forms

GDPR
AICPA SOC 2
PCI
HIPAA
CCPA
FDA

End-to-end document management

From editing and signing to collaboration and tracking, pdfFiller has everything you need to get your documents done quickly and efficiently.

Accessible from anywhere

pdfFiller is fully cloud-based. This means you can edit, sign, and share documents from anywhere using your computer, smartphone, or tablet.

Secure and compliant

pdfFiller lets you securely manage documents following global laws like ESIGN, CCPA, and GDPR. It's also HIPAA and SOC 2 compliant.
Form preview

What is Credit Card Release

The Credit Card Authorization Release is a business form used by SCCA Pro Racing participants to authorize fees related to participation in racing series.

pdfFiller scores top ratings on review platforms

Users Most Likely To Recommend - Summer 2025
Grid Leader in Small-Business - Summer 2025
High Performer - Summer 2025
Regional Leader - Summer 2025
Show more Show less
Fill fillable Credit Card Release form: Try Risk Free
Rate free Credit Card Release form
4.9
satisfied
27 votes

Who needs Credit Card Release?

Explore how professionals across industries use pdfFiller.
Picture
Credit Card Release is needed by:
  • SCCA Pro Racing participants
  • Team managers handling racing fees
  • Drivers who participate in multiple events
  • Financial departments within racing teams
  • Sponsors requiring payment authorization

Comprehensive Guide to Credit Card Release

What is the Credit Card Authorization Release?

The Credit Card Authorization Release is a crucial document for participants in SCCA Pro Racing. It serves to authorize the SCCA to charge participation fees directly to a specified credit card. Updated last in 2010, this form's relevance remains high for current racing participants, ensuring they remain compliant with the latest expectations regarding racing fees.
This authorization release simplifies the payment process, ensuring drivers can focus on their performance on the track without worrying about payment issues.

Purpose and Benefits of the Credit Card Authorization Release

This form is designed to facilitate the smooth payment of fees associated with racing events. By pre-authorizing charges, drivers can enjoy several benefits:
  • Convenience in pre-authorizing fees for multiple racing events.
  • Assurance of timely payments, allowing drivers to concentrate on their racing schedules.
Utilizing the credit card authorization template ensures that all racing participation fees are efficiently managed.

Key Features of the Credit Card Authorization Release

The Credit Card Authorization Release includes several essential components that users must complete to ensure proper processing. Key features of the form include:
  • Required fields such as team name, driver's name, car number, and credit card details.
  • Signature requirements that mandate annual submission by the driver.
Completing this SCCA Pro Racing form accurately enhances the efficiency of the racing participation process.

Who Needs the Credit Card Authorization Release?

This form is critical for all SCCA Pro Racing participants. Specifically, it is necessary for drivers, who must provide their signatures on the document. Racing teams and individuals involved in motorsport activities will also need to use this document to ensure compliance with participation requirements.
Understanding the role of the driver and the necessity for their signature is essential for a smooth submission process.

How to Fill Out the Credit Card Authorization Release Online

Completing the Credit Card Authorization Release online can be streamlined with tools like pdfFiller. Follow these steps to ensure accuracy:
  • Access the form via pdfFiller.
  • Fill in each required field with accurate information.
  • Review entries carefully to avoid common mistakes.
Utilizing an online platform can help minimize errors and expedite the form-filling process.

Review and Validation Checklist for the Credit Card Authorization Release

Before submitting the Credit Card Authorization Release, users should perform a comprehensive review. Key points to check include:
  • Correct signatures are provided.
  • Data accuracy, particularly for credit card details, to avoid processing issues.
Taking the time to validate information ensures that the document meets all requirements for submission.

How to Submit and Deliver the Credit Card Authorization Release

Submitting the Credit Card Authorization Release can be done through various methods. Here are the submission options:
  • Electronically via pdfFiller for quick processing.
  • By mail for those preferring physical submissions.
Be sure to adhere to submission deadlines to ensure timely processing of the racing participation fees.

Security and Compliance with the Credit Card Authorization Release

When handling the Credit Card Authorization Release, security is paramount. The platform utilized, such as pdfFiller, offers robust security features, including:
  • 256-bit encryption to protect sensitive information.
  • Compliance with standards such as SOC 2 Type II, HIPAA, and GDPR.
The emphasis on data protection ensures that users’ credit card details remain secure throughout the process.

How pdfFiller Enhances Your Experience with the Credit Card Authorization Release

pdfFiller significantly improves the user experience with the Credit Card Authorization Release by offering features such as:
  • Edit and customize the form as needed.
  • eSigning capabilities for convenience.
  • Document management tools including archiving and sharing options.
This cloud-based solution ensures that users can access and manage their documents from anywhere, enhancing the overall ease of filling out forms.

Get Started with Your Credit Card Authorization Release Today!

Access and utilize the Credit Card Authorization Release form on pdfFiller to take advantage of its essential features. Should you have any questions or need assistance, do not hesitate to reach out for support.
Last updated on Sep 30, 2015

How to fill out the Credit Card Release

  1. 1.
    Access pdfFiller and search for 'Credit Card Authorization Release'. Select the form from the search results to open it.
  2. 2.
    Familiarize yourself with the layout of the form, including the blank fields and checkboxes provided for class selection.
  3. 3.
    Before filling out the form, gather necessary information such as the team name, driver's name, car number, class, credit card type, the name on the card, credit card number, and its expiration date.
  4. 4.
    Begin filling out each field systematically, ensuring you enter accurate and complete information.
  5. 5.
    Utilize the checkboxes for selecting the racing class, confirming eligibility for each selected category as needed.
  6. 6.
    Leave the signature line and date fields blank for now, as you'll need to sign the completed form privately.
  7. 7.
    Once all fields are filled out, review the form carefully for any errors or missing information.
  8. 8.
    Make sure all details are accurate and correspond to the information on your credit card and racing documents.
  9. 9.
    When satisfied with the information, proceed to save your work by selecting the 'Save' option on pdfFiller.
  10. 10.
    You can also download the completed form directly to your device or submit it electronically through the platform's submission options.
Regular content decoration

FAQs

If you can't find what you're looking for, please contact us anytime!
Any driver participating in SCCA Pro Racing events is eligible to fill out this form, as it is necessary for authorizing charging participation fees.
Yes, the form must be submitted annually prior to participation in SCCA Pro Racing events to ensure that fees are authorized for the upcoming season.
You can submit the filled form electronically via pdfFiller or download it and email or mail it directly to the SCCA Pro Racing organization.
While no additional documents are required, it is recommended to have identification or proof of association with the racing team available during the submission.
Ensure that all fields are filled out completely and accurately. Double-check credit card information for errors and avoid leaving any required fields blank.
Processing times can vary, but typically, you should expect a confirmation of processing within a few business days after submission.
If you have questions, refer to the SCCA Pro Racing website or contact their support team for detailed assistance related to the Credit Card Authorization Release.
If you believe that this page should be taken down, please follow our DMCA take down process here .
This form may include fields for payment information. Data entered in these fields is not covered by PCI DSS compliance.